config: Implemented multi-target support
With this patch support for building multiple targets in parallel with bitbake is now supported. Changes: - Its now possible to state a list of targets under the target key in the configuration file. Example: target: - product-image - product-update-image - Its now possible to define multiple targets in the kas command line. Example: $ kas build --target product-image --target product-update-image \ kas.yml - Its now possible to define multiple targets via the environment: Example: $ export KAS_TARGET="product-image product-update-image" $ kas build kas.yml Signed-off-by: Claudius Heine <ch@denx.de>
